I guess, it's all about Google's business model.
On Nexus 7, their Android tablet, you can rent movies and the likes from Google Play. All cloud based, no need for memory expansion.
On Chromebook Pixel, there's no Google Play. You can access it via web browser of course. But you don't find any HD++ movies, that would show the capabilities.
I've tested a 30GB rip of Avatar for example.
So, to bring movies on a unit with such a great display, you either have to connect a USB drive or put it on an SD card.
